Using USGS topo data is really easy in Bryce. You can import it as a .psd, a .pgm. or raw. I would reccommend converting the raw data to one of the first two file formats. If you have a PC, use 3DEM. If you have a Mac, use MacDEM to import the raw data and export it as a .psd. Then you can...
